Friction, impact, and abrasive grinding continuously compromise metallurgical integrity, leading to premature equipment failures and expensive downtime. Among the various wear-protection methodologies, weld overlay cladding (WOC) using MIG welding flux cored wire stands out as the most cost-effective and structurally robust solution available.
This technical whitepaper provides deep insights into the molecular metallurgy of chromium carbide alloys, maps out macro-industrial applications, and offers a comprehensive guide for global procurement managers seeking strategic OEM/ODM partnerships.
MIG (Metal Inert Gas) welding with flux-cored wire—especially self-shielded formulations—presents massive deposition advantages over solid wire counterparts. The flux core contains a precise mixture of alloying elements, deoxidizers, and slag-forming agents. When subjected to the electric arc, these materials synthesize a highly protective environment and generate a tailored microstructure upon cooling.
For high-abrasion applications, the precipitation of primary M7C3 chromium carbides within a tough austenitic or martensitic matrix is vital. The hardness of these carbides (typically 1200–1600 HV) acts as a microscopic barrier against abrasive particles, while the surrounding matrix provides the necessary fracture toughness to absorb operational impacts. Achieving this balance requires strict manufacturing parameters, precise chemical formulation of the core powders, and advanced draw-bench calibration.

The hardfacing industry is undergoing rapid changes driven by automation, material science breakthroughs, and environmental requirements:
Robotic Cladding Systems: Automated cladding is replacing manual surfacing. Equipment with multiple welding guns working simultaneously reduces cycle times and provides extremely consistent bead geometries, reducing heat input and parent material dilution.
High-Entropy Alloys (HEAs): The research department is exploring multi-element alloy systems that offer superior wear resistance under high temperatures and corrosive environments compared to traditional chromium-iron alloys.
Green Metallurgical Engineering: Maximizing component service life directly reduces global carbon footprints. Extending the life of steel components helps save resources and minimizes the energy required for manufacturing replacement structural steel parts.

See Chute Projects >Our RX® surfacing equipment provides high-efficiency, automated overlay capabilities with a compact footprint and simple maintenance procedures. These systems are designed to produce wear-resistant composite steel plates, repair grinding rolls, and rebuild mill tables. They support solid-core, flux-cored, and self-shielded wires in open-arc, metal-arc, or submerged-arc welding configurations.
Equipped with an advanced numerical control system accessed through a 10.2-inch touchscreen, the unit allows operators to adjust oscillation speed and weld path parameters. The mechanism features four welding guns that can operate simultaneously or independently. The centralized control system offers real-time adjustment of welding currents and speeds, ensuring high-quality, repeatable weld overlays.
